> 5 In mathematics, what shape are asymptotes and hyperbolas?

A hyperbola consists of a symmetrical arrangement of two curves, each
convex on one side which faces toward the other, like ") (". An asymptote
is a straight line. A hyperbola, for example, has two asymptotes, which
cross at the figure's center of symmetry, like ")X(".
